Summary of Functions:
To ensure professional execution for Northern Quest Resort and Casino client's banquets, meetings and functions of all types and sizes in all areas. Responsible for high level of guest satisfaction and superior service for events such as weddings, Christmas parties, and be in attendance of Northern Quest concerts and major events.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
- Provide constant, attentive and friendly service to all guests, greets guests in appropriate manner.
- Serve beverages according to Mandatory Alcohol Service Training (MAST) guidelines.
- Assist banquet Team Members (Servers, Bartenders, Set-up Porters, Cocktail Servers and Ushers, and Beverage Porters) to ensure superior guest service.
- Review the client's needs or special requests, in order to deliver a flawless performance, while maintaining very high standards.
- Complete all side work in a timely and satisfactory manner to ensure a clean, neat work area with adequate supply level.
- Correctly perform all necessary paper and bookwork at shifts end.
- Relay any complaints, problems or positive remarks to shift supervisor.
- Attend all training meetings.
- Keep storage areas clean and organized. Make sure that equipment is cleaned properly and stored securely.
- Responsible for maintaining a good attendance record.
- May be required to be a panelist for the Internal Review Board Process.
- Must be able to execute multiple tasks at the same time, while staying focused and organized.
- Coordinate special arrangements and needs with the appropriate departments for the operation.
- Knowledge of food and wine for training service.
- Help organize clearing stations and Back of House.
- Work along with the Culinary Team, in the setting of buffet tables and other food displays.
- Inspect the overall ambiance of the room to meet the need of the client.
- Make certain that the tables are set according to Northern Quest Casino standards and the requirement of the function and the client.
- In the absence of a supervisor or manager, meet and greet clients at the beginning of their function and communicate with them through the duration of their event.
- Follows Northern Quest Casino procedures for "Room Control" pertaining to guest conduct and alcohol use.

Hiring Preference The Kalispel Tribe of Indians is an Equal opportunity employer. Consistent with federal law, the Kalispel Tribe of Indians applies Indian preference in employment. It is the policy of the Kalispel Tribe of Indians to give preference in hiring, promotions, and transfers into vacant positions to qualified applicants in the following order: 1) Kalispel Tribal Members; 2) Spouses of an enrolled Kalispel Tribal Member; 3) enrolled members of other Indian Tribes; 4) all other applicants.
